Tax season can sometimes feel like an impending storm, but it doesn’t have to be overwhelming! The first step to conquering tax season is being well aware of those crucial deadlines. Typically, tax returns need to be filed by April 15. But if you sense that you might need a bit more time, applying for an extension is an option worth considering. Just keep in mind that even with an extension, any taxes owed still need to be settled by that original deadline!
By staying ahead of deadlines, you can significantly reduce your stress levels and give yourself plenty of time to gather your documents carefully. A fun tip is to mark those important due dates on your calendar—perhaps with some colorful stickers or creative reminders to keep the mood light!
Organizing Your Financial Documents
Once you’ve got those deadlines in check, the next step is organizing your financial documents. Think of it as preparing for a big exam: having everything sorted out can make a world of difference in building your confidence! Collect your W-2s, 1099s, receipts for any deductions, and any other paperwork you’ll need. When it comes time to file your taxes, you’ll be grateful for this organized approach.
By taking the time to establish a straightforward filing system, you’ll not only streamline the process but also find peace of mind, knowing you have everything right at your fingertips!
Utilizing Technology
We live in an extraordinary era where technology can be an invaluable ally, especially during tax season. Tax software can simplify your experience, guiding you step-by-step through the filing process while helping you maximize your deductions. Many of these programs offer e-filing options, allowing you to speed up the refund process significantly.
Additionally, mobile apps make it easy to track expenses and income no matter where you are. Isn’t it incredible that we can manage our finances right from our smartphones? Plus, many employers provide digital IRS forms, which reduces paper clutter and makes the submission process even smoother.
